Dr. Olszewska is the Director of the Office of Student Rights and Responsibilities. It is her office that handles students’ actions based on the ECU code of conduct. I found it necessary to see if she knew anything about how drunk driving was looked at by the university. She explained to me that her office handled students cited as drunk driving by the police, and judged them based on the university guidelines. She also explained to me the steps in which her office would take to combat an issue. First they would require the student to receive an alcohol assessment. Based upon the assessment’s results, the students may receive up to a one-year suspension from East Carolina. At the end of this period if the student chooses to come back to East Carolina they will be warned that if they are ever found to be driving drunk again, they will be suspended indefinitely from attending East Carolina.
